There are two common ways to categorize humans: personality types and biological sexes. One popular model for personality types is the Myers-Briggs Type Indicator (MBTI), which identifies 16 distinct personality types. In terms of biological categorization, humans are generally classified into two sexes: male and female. However, it’s important to note that both personality and biological sex can exist on a spectrum.
